Crank no start.

1977 Ford F250 4x4 with a 400ci. Tried starting truck today. But wont start.
As i noticed there is no spark on crank. But when turning key off it will spark when ignition switch is turned off. I did repleace the igntion switch. To no avail still same problem. So i changed the coil and wires and cap and rotor. Which needed to be done. And still there's no spark.
Is there away to test the pick up in the distrubtor.
and also is there away to test the Ignition Control Module? . Thanks Brian.

That doesn't make any difference, the ignition components from mid 70s to mid 80s were very similar and use the same tests. You have duraspark II, the duraspark I was only in cars in the early 70s as far as I recall. The pickups switched from points to electronic ignition in '75 and jumped straight to duraspark II. 351M/400/460 all use same dizzy.

The single spark when shutting off the power is caused by the field collapsing. This also proves that there's current flow though the DS2 ingition module and that it's power ON.
The 12 volts on the green wire must have been measured with the 4 wire plug disconnect.
Is the rotor turning?

Per the manual, you are supposed to be able to hit the distributor, near the pickup, with a screw driver handle. Each whack is supposed to produce a single spark. The HIT is supposed to SHOCK the magnetic pickup, and send the small voltage spike to the DS2 ingition module. If the test works, it proves the ignition module is OK.
Personally this seems a little magical , but it has been done by others.

You can also measure the gap, tooth to magnet. It's not adjustable, but to big of a gap and it won't work. Or if its rubbing , it won't work.

You should do this test at the 4 wire connector on the DS2 ingition module, as this will also test the wiring all the way to the ingition module.
Not sure if you tested at the distributor or ingition module.
You know that the ground is good, because the module is powering ON

Also, do a key ON , coil positive voltage test with everything connected in a RUN configuration. Should be about 6 to 8 volts.
